PlayWay S.A. increased its ownership stake in Madmind Studio to 78% following the acquisition of three additional shares on July 19, 2017.
The acquisition consolidates PlayWay S.A.'s position as the dominant shareholder in the Bydgoszcz-based developer.
The strategic move is primarily focused on aligning PlayWay S.A.'s investment portfolio with the development and commercial potential of Madmind Studio's title, Agony.
This transaction reflects a broader industry trend of publishers securing majority stakes in specialized studios to streamline production pipelines and control intellectual property.
The deal targets expansion within the Polish game development sector, specifically focusing on the PC and console markets where Madmind Studio operates.
The corporate action was formally disclosed as inside information, underscoring its impact on PlayWay S.A.'s financial structure and asset distribution.
